Fabric Metallization Technology
Noble Biomaterials uses proprietary technology to permanently bond pure silver to the surface of a polymer substrate, including yarn, fiber, fabric, tape, and foam. These materials can be blended with natural or man-made fibers for superior design flexibility. Special formulations can protect against galvanic reactions and oxidization. The result is a highly conductive, durable, lightweight, flexible, washable material with 360-degree permanent encapsulation coating. Frequency Ranges
Noble Biomaterials provides flexible shielding protection from 30 MHz through 30 GHz range of the electromagnetic spectrum and attenuation values between 30 dB (99.9%) up to 90 dB (99.9999999%).
